Emergency pediatric care in the Dominican Republic often requires upfront payment at private facilities. While public hospitals treat life-threatening conditions without immediate funds, private clinics like INNOVA CLINIC PUNTA CANA usually ask for a deposit. International travel insurance guarantees can often bypass these initial out-of-pocket costs.

Pediatricians in the Dominican Republic frequently treat mosquito-borne illnesses like dengue and chikungunya. They also manage respiratory infections and gastrointestinal disorders. Doctors routinely handle common childhood rashes. Specialized clinics like INNOVA CLINIC PUNTA CANA provide pediatric care for international families and residents.

Patient Consensus: Parents note that local doctors are very familiar with mosquito-borne symptoms. Many emphasize watching for dehydration and poor urine output during stomach bugs. Safe food and water practices are vital to avoid common gastrointestinal issues.
